ABOUT SMART
 

The USBC offers millions of dollars in scholarship money to help young bowlers get a jump start on their dreams. More than $7 million in scholarship money is offered each season by bowling associations and councils, certified tournaments and proprietors throughout the United States.
 

SMART, which stands for Scholarship Management and Account Reporting for Tenpins, is a program that began operation in 1994 as a service offering the bowling community a centralized location to manage bowling scholarship funds as well as providing USBC members with a resource for inquiries about bowling scholarships. In 2010, the SMART Bowling Scholarship Funding Corporation was created as an independent entity dedicated to the management, protection and promotion of the SMART scholarship funds.  
 

SMART oversees bowling organizations' scholarship funds for individuals who have earned scholarships. USBC's SMART staff provides complimentary assistance for recipients and providers.

SCHOLARSHIPS AVAILABLE FOR THE WI PEPSI-USBC TOURNAMENT
Thanks to money that the association has from “lapsed Coke/Pepsi scholarships” we will be awarding additional scholarships to bowlers at the regional and state competitions!

  • Girls bowling a 275 or higher game or 700 series will receive a $100 scholarship.
  • Boys bowling a 290 or higher game or 750 series will also receive a $100 scholarship.

A bowler may win only one game award and one series award per event (regional and state are considered separate events). So the maximum number of $100 scholarships that may be earned in a single tournament season will be four.

All scholarship money will be placed on deposit at SMART.  For more information, contact the BCAW Office.
